MetLife has an employee rating of 3.7 out of 5 stars, based on 6,429 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The MetLife employ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Seguros industry (3.6 stars).

Pros

- Ability to earn more based on performance - Remote position

Cons

- High employee turnover - Punishing call volume; not a nanosecond to ponder the mysteries of life - Constant Microsoft Teams meetings with supervisors, including pointless 1on1 meetings to discuss your performance - Once had my supervisor tell me 'you talk to customers like they're not even human' because she felt I neglected to use the kind of prefabricated phrases management expects you to use even if the customer themselves is very satisfied and gives you a glowing review. - Myriad technical issues that upset customers and cause them serious hardship are rarely addressed
